About the Role

We are seeking a Senior Scientist I that is highly motivated, flexible and an adaptive team player for the Antibody Discovery group within Biologics Research Center (BRC) Cambridge, MA. In this role, you will participate in the generation of high-quality biologics to initiate and competitively advance the NIBR biologics pipeline by independently performing antibody screening followed by binding and functional characterization.

This division is the innovation engine of Novartis, focusing on new technologies that have the potential to help produce therapeutic breakthroughs for patients. The Biologics Research Center (BRC) is accommodated within NIBR. BRC, in collaboration with the disease areas and technical expert groups, builds the future biologics therapy pipeline of Novartis through the discovery and creation of new antibody, protein, nucleic acid and virus-based molecules.

Your Key Responsibilities:

  • Apply multiple innovative selection techniques to synthetic and immune antibody libraries, like phage display, yeast display, FACS sorting, plate-based screening.

  • Use automation to support antibody production, purification, and screening

  • Sub-clone hits into expression vectors and produce them at micro-scale in a high-throughput manner.

  • Characterize binders properties in various affinity and activity assays, like ELISA, iQue, FACS, Octet, epitope binning, reporter gene assays.

  • Engineer and improve binders by means of affinity maturation or humanization.

  • Generate hypotheses to test, troubleshoot issues, design and execute the next set of experiments with the input from senior team members or manager.

  • Document the results in a detailed manner in laboratory journal and in internal databases.

  • Present research updates and participate constructively in working project teams and at laboratory group meetings.

Role Requirements

Essential Requirements:

  • B.S. with at least 6 years, or M.S. with at least 4 years in Biological Sciences with laboratory experience in antibody discovery technologies, including at least one technology like phage or yeast display.

  • Solid background in molecular biology, cell biology, biochemistry, affinity and activity assays.

  • Self-motivation, enthusiasm, and scientific curiosity.

Desirable Requirements:

  • Experience in antibody engineering, especially affinity maturation is highly desirable.

  • Knowledge in flow cytometry (analysis and sorting) is desirable.

  • Familiarity with laboratory automation is desirable.
